Retzia capensis is a unique plant and is the only member of the genus. It is such a beautiful fiery plant – more investigation needed! The upper zones of the leaves (rhythmic system) becomes infused with a fiery flowering principle and the fieriness continues into the flower, so much so that the tips of the petals are black-tipped as if burnt. It is rare to find black in a flower. The common name is Heuningblom (Honey Flower), as the flowers contain abundant nectar and are pollinated by the Orange-Breasted Sunbird (Anthobaphes violacea), also the only member of its genus. Note the wonderful concordance of their colouring.
